I celebrate and recreate American music inspired by vintage blues, including jazz, honky tonk and rock & roll. I also perform original songs that capture the "old school" sound of the recognized masters of those genres.
As a life-long a professional musician and teacher, I've helped hundreds of guitarists along their musician's journey. My teaching philosophy is pretty simple - "Those who can do, those who think others can too, teach."
Living a creative life with purpose and integrity is challenging and rewarding. As a professional musician and teacher, I've dedicated myself to discovering, cultivating, and sharing my artistic voice and helping others do the same.

Acoustic jazz guitar with a distinctive reso-phonic sound and a vintage blues vibe that swings like a hot club band. Features two original songs; the minor keyed Hazel Eyes features a latin groove and Monkfish Blues, Scott's tribute to Thelonius Monk.

Genuine traditional and original acoustic blues and roots music resound from Scott Perry's National Reso-phonic guitar. Scott's songbook draws from traditional blues, ragtime, Tin Pan Alley, old time, jazz and mountain guitar, along with original songs in these traditions. An old-school sound that resonates today
